Type A Personality Style
A personality pattern characterized by hostility, cynicism, drivenness, impatience, competitiveness, and ambition.
Cynical
An attitude characterized by a belief that people are motivated purely by self-interest.
Competitive
A trait or situation where individuals or entities strive against each other to achieve a goal or superiority.
